Are you struggling to define your personal style? Creating a personal style edit can be a daunting task, but it’s essential for building a wardrobe that reflects your unique personality and taste. With these five easy tips, you’ll be on your way to crafting a personal style edit that speaks to you.

Tip 1: Identify Your Style Icons

One of the easiest ways to uncover your personal style is to look for inspiration from fashion icons who share your taste. Take note of the outfits they wear that you love, and try to identify specific style elements that appeal to you. You might find that you’re attracted to bold colors, statement accessories, or tailored silhouettes. Take these style cues and add them to your personal style edit.

Tip 2: Purge Your Closet

Before you start building your personal style edit, take stock of your current wardrobe. Remove any items that no longer fit or feel like they don’t reflect your personal style. Consider donating or selling items that don’t fit with your new personal style edit, and you’ll be closer to curating a wardrobe that truly reflects you.

Tip 3: Invest in Quality Basics

Building a personal style edit starts with investing in high-quality basics. These are the pieces that will form the foundation of your wardrobe and provide a neutral canvas for your personal style to shine. Look for well-made t-shirts, classic jeans, and versatile jackets that can be dressed up or down. By investing in quality basics, you’ll be setting yourself up for a wardrobe that stands the test of time.

Tip 4: Mix and Match for Versatility

Try to choose pieces that can be mixed and matched in different ways to create a variety of outfits. This will ensure that you get the most bang for your buck when building your personal style edit. Look for items that can be dressed up or down, like a simple black dress or a classic blazer. By mixing and matching, you’ll be able to create endless outfit combinations without needing to buy new pieces.

Tip 5: Embrace Your Unique Style

Finally, it’s important to remember that your personal style edit should reflect your unique personality and taste. Experiment with accessories and statement pieces that speak to you, even if they’re not on-trend. Don’t be afraid to take risks and try something new. After all, the most stylish people are the ones who stay true to themselves.
